P059D
Active Grille Air Shutter A Position Sensor Circuit Low

Symptoms
- Check Engine light is on
- Blinds are not controlled automatically, fixed in one position
- Decreased fuel efficiency on the highway
- Slow engine warm-up in cold weather
- Possible increase in coolant temperature when the shutters are closed
Causes
- Broken signal wire of the blind position sensor
- Signal wire short circuit to ground
- Break in the sensor power wire (reference voltage +5 V)
- Faulty position sensor (no output signal)
- Oxidation or destruction of the sensor connector
How to Fix
- Read all error codes with scanner
- Inspect the connector and wiring of the blind position sensor
- Check the presence of reference voltage (+5 V) at the sensor connector with the ignition on
- Measure the signal voltage of the sensor and check the integrity of the signal wire
- Check the ground wire of the sensor for a break and the reliability of the connection to the body
- If there is no signal and the wiring is in good condition, replace the position sensor
- Reset error codes and check system operation
